Frontignano is a small ski area located in the Sibillini Mountains, part of the Macerata province in the Marche region. Nestled at an elevation of around 1,350 meters (4,430 feet), this is an ideal place for winter sports enthusiasts, offering stunning views, well-groomed slopes, and an authentic alpine vibe. This area is perfect for skiers and snowboarders who seek fewer crowds and a more tranquil experience compared to larger ski resorts. Monte Bove is one of the most iconic peaks in the Sibillini Mountains and provides an unforgettable backdrop to the Frontignano ski area. Standing at 2,169 meters (7,116 feet),it is famous for its rugged, snow-covered cliffs and towering presence over the ski slopes.

1. Sibillini Mountains National Park

The Sibillini Mountains National Park is a haven for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ts. This expansive park offers numerous hiking trails that traverse through lush forests, breathtaking mountain landscapes, and serene valleys. You can enjoy activities such as trekking, bird watching, and mountain biking.

  • Fauna and Flora: Discover a wide range of wildlife including deer, wolves, and golden eagles. The park is also rich in diverse plant species that add to the vibrant scenery.
  • Visiting Points: Don’t miss places like Lago di Pilato, famous for its unique glacial formation, and the many picturesque villages scattered throughout the park.

4. Castelluccio di Norcia and its Blooming Fields

A short drive away, Castelluccio di Norcia is famous for its colorful flowering fields. The "flowering" occurs from late May to early July, when the rolling fields burst into vibrant colors with poppies, cornflowers, and lentils in bloom.

  • Scenic Drives: Enjoy the scenic drive up to the plateau, offering sweeping views of the flowering meadows against the backdrop of the Sibillini mountains.
  • Photogenic Panorama: This natural spectacle is a paradise for photographers, providing an array of colors and textures to capture.
